Abstract
The invention discloses an antistatic transparent adhesive tape. The antistatic transparent adhesive tape is obtained by bonding a BOPP film, glue and an adhesive, the BOPP film is made by using a base cloth and a conductive filler, the base cloth is a polypropylene material, the conductive filler is formed by carbon black and talcum powder, the glue is acrylate glue, the adhesive is a white latex, and the glue and the BOPP film are bonded by the adhesive. By adopting the above mode, the obtained adhesive tape has a strong viscosity and has an antistatic efficacy.

Embodiment
Below the present invention will be described in detail, thereby so that advantages and features of the invention can be easier to be it will be appreciated by those skilled in the art that, protection scope of the present invention is made to more explicit defining.
A kind of anti-electrostatic scotch tape, by BOPP film, glue and glue paste, be bonded, described BOPP film is made by base cloth and conductive filler material, described base cloth is polypropylene material, described conductive filler material consists of carbon black and talcum powder, described glue is CALCIUM ACRYLATE glue, and described glue paste is white glue with vinyl, and described glue and described BOPP film are by described glue paste adhering junction.
Further illustrate, in described BOPP film, the content of base cloth is 85-90%, and the content of conductive filler material is 10-15%, and in described conductive filler material, the content of carbon black is 30-40%, and talcous content is 60-70%.In BOPP film, conductive filler material only needs on a small quantity, just can play the effect of anti-electrostatic, the content of the conductive filler material therefore adopting is 10-15%, the material of residue 85-90% content is base cloth, and the Main Function of carbon black is to strengthen the wear-resistant type of conductive filler material in conductive filler material, talcous Main Function is to strengthen the conductive capability of conductive filler material, and therefore adopting the content of carbon black is 30-40%, talcous content is 60-70%
Further illustrate again, first first by carbon black and talcum powder in conjunction with forming conductive filler material, then by conductive filler material, the mode by high temperature polymerization invests base cloth top layer and makes BOPP film, make BOPP film possess the function of anti-electrostatic, described base cloth is polypropylene material, and properties of transparency is good, and resistance toheat and water resistance that can strongthener, and then by the glue paste of white glue with vinyl, glue is adhered on BOPP thin film layer, thereby make scotch tape.
